In Aigle, visitors can enjoy skiing and hiking at Les Diablerets, explore the Aigle Vineyards with wine tasting tours, and visit the Swiss Vapeur Parc for a family-friendly miniature railway experience. For adventure seekers, Parc Aventure Aigle offers exciting zip lines and treetop courses. The Aigle Market is perfect for discovering local products and delicacies. Notable sights include the historic Aigle Castle with its Vine and Wine Museum, the scenic Les Pléiades with hiking trails, and the Jardin Botanique de St-Triphon for alpine flora. The Aigle-Leysin Railway provides a picturesque train journey, and Château de la Roche offers charming historical architecture and gardens.
Aigle, known for its picturesque vineyards and historical sites, can be explored comfortably in 1 to 2 days, allowing time to visit attractions like Aigle Castle and nearby wine regions.
